15 Covering Foundations for Perfect Skin for Sunny Days

As the weather starts to warm up and the days get longer, many people are starting to think about how they can achieve that perfect, glowing complexion. However, with so many different products and techniques out there, it can be overwhelming to figure out what will work best for your skin. One approach that can help is to focus on using a range of different foundations that can provide coverage without looking too heavy or unnatural.
  1. Tinted moisturizer: A lightweight, sheer option that can provide some coverage while also hydrating your skin.
  2. BB cream: Similar to a tinted moisturizer but with added skincare benefits, such as SPF and antioxidants.
  3. CC cream: Like a BB cream, but with color-correcting properties to help even out skin tone.
  4. Cushion foundation: A compact with a sponge that dispenses a lightweight, buildable foundation.
  5. Mineral foundation: A powder-based foundation that can provide coverage without feeling heavy or cakey.
  6. Stick foundation: A convenient option for on-the-go touch-ups or quick coverage.
  7. Serum foundation: A lightweight, serum-like foundation that can provide a natural-looking finish.
  8. Liquid foundation: A classic option that can be buildable and provide a range of coverage levels.
  9. Powder foundation: A matte option that can help control oil and provide a natural-looking finish.
  10. Cream foundation: A hydrating option that can provide medium to full coverage.
  11. Water-based foundation: A lightweight, breathable option that can provide a dewy finish.
  12. Airbrush foundation: A spray-on option that can provide a flawless, airbrushed finish.
  13. Mousse foundation: A lightweight, whipped texture that can provide medium to full coverage.
  14. Sheer foundation: A natural-looking option that can provide a hint of coverage without looking too heavy.
  15. Buildable foundation: A versatile option that can be layered to provide varying levels of coverage.

A few tips and tricks to keep in mind to help ensure a flawless finish. First, make sure to start with clean, well-hydrated skin. This will help the foundation go on smoothly and evenly. Additionally, consider using a primer or other base product to help smooth out your skin’s texture and prolong the wear of your foundation.

When applying your foundation, use a light hand and build up coverage gradually. This can help ensure that you don’t end up with a heavy or cakey finish. Consider using a damp beauty sponge or brush to blend your foundation for a seamless, natural-looking finish. Set your foundation with a powder or setting spray to help lock it in place and prevent it from sliding off throughout the day.
